🌱 Orson’s Tummy Troubles and the Pumpkin Miracle

(aka The Great Pumpkin)

I’ll never forget the week Orson got hit with a bout of digestion drama (yes, the dreaded runny poop situation 🙈). I was about to panic over a potential vet bill when my mother-in-law suggested adding a spoonful of plain pumpkin puree to his meals.

Within 24 hours—boom. His stomach calmed, and his energy was back. Not only did it save me a vet trip, but it also taught me that sometimes simple, natural solutions can make a world of difference.

Pumpkin is rich in fiber and nutrients, making it a natural gut-soother for many dogs. Now, I always keep a can in the pantry “just in case.”

🌼 The Calming Power of Lavender for Stress

Orson is usually pretty chill during thunderstorms, but fireworks? Forget it. He paces, whimpers, and becomes a little bundle of nerves. Last 4th of July, desperate to ease his stress, I tried diffusing lavender essential oil in the room (being careful to use a pet-safe dilution and keeping it well out of his reach).

To my surprise, it worked. Within minutes, he stretched out, sighed, and drifted off to sleep beside me. 🌙

It wasn’t magic—it was the gentle, calming effect of aromatherapy. And it was a beautiful reminder that holistic remedies aren’t about curing everything—they’re about supporting comfort and balance.


More Natural Wellness Ideas for Your Pup

Here are a few holistic practices that other dog parents (myself included) have found helpful:

  • Coconut oil for skin and coat health 🥥

  • Chamomile tea (cooled) as an occasional tummy soother 🌼

  • Gentle massage to relieve stiffness and anxiety 💆‍♂️🐾

  • Probiotics for gut balance and immunity 🦠

Always check with your vet before introducing new remedies—but don’t be afraid to explore the natural toolbox nature provides.


a veterinarian smiles at the camera while comforting a small dog

A very important bit of advice that goes hand-in-hand with talking with your vet about natural remedies: just because it's a safe remedy for people, doesn't make it safe for dogs! While there are lots of in-common remedies, you definitely don't want to introduce a toxic substance to your dog while trying to heal them! Always check with your vet! Checking with your vet doesn't necessarily mean making an appointment. Some veterinary offices are happy to advise you over the phone with a straightforward question or give you details in an email.
